gpt4 book ai didi

vbscript - 如何获取完整的用户名?

转载 作者:行者123 更新时间:2023-12-02 19:25:33 24 4
gpt4 key购买 nike

我在 VBS 中有以下代码,可以完美运行。它查询 AD 以获取用户全名:

Set objSysInfo = CreateObject("ADSystemInfo")
strUser = objSysInfo.UserName
Set objUser = GetObject("LDAP://" & strUser)
strFullName = objUser.Get("displayName")
MsgBox strFullName

我想做同样的事情,但是在 Foxpro 7 中。有人有 VFP 7 或 9 的经验吗?

最佳答案

sys(0) 返回计算机名称和用户,类似于

lcMachineUser = sys(0)
lcMachine = LEFT( lcMachineUser, AT( "#", lcMachineUser) -1 )
lcUserName = substr( lcMachineUser, AT( "#", lcMachineUser) +1 )

关于vbscript - 如何获取完整的用户名?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14587568/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com